How much does it cost to rent a home in Ocean?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Ocean 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,342 | $1,650 | $10,000+ |
| Ocean 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,616 | $1,800 | $10,000+ |
| Ocean 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,876 | $1,875 | $10,000+ |
| Ocean 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,070 | $2,500 | $10,000+ |
| Ocean 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,801 | $2,700 | $9,500 |
| Ocean 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$8,085 | $2,800 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Ocean
What type of rentals are currently available in Ocean?
There are currently 648 Apartments for Rent in Ocean, NJ with pricing that ranges from $1,059 to $11,540. There are also 371 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Ocean ranging from $850 to $65,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Ocean?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Ocean ranges from $850 to $65,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,061.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Ocean?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Ocean range from $2,500 to $8,500,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,800 to $12,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,875 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$3,400.
